Here are some reasons of how air conditioning helps people to fight stress. • •
Heat Spoils the Mood • There have been many studies have been carried out in the past to check on this aspect, and researchers understood that the mood of a person depends primarily on the temperature in the area. When the temperature is too high, there is a probability that the person might get irritated quickly as it can turn into quite an uncomfortable working environment. People cannot withstand the stress when the room is hot – when you turn on the air conditioning system, one does not have to struggle with the temperature and preventable stress they face at work or home. They will remain calm and pleasant even during stressful situations at the office. •
Performance At Work Improves • People can perform well at work when the workspace is cool and comfortable – just imagine how their stress levels can increase when the working environment is too hot to sit and do their work. People will not perform at their best due to feeling uncomfortable, sweaty and claustrophobic; they might lose concentration levels or more feel tired than usual within half-day working. Get Some Good Sleep • Sleep plays a huge role on how we cope during the day and is one of the primary reasons why people suffer from stress and other related problems is because they had poor sleep. During summer and the heat of the night, it can be difficult to get a proper, restful sleep. When people do not sleep well, it can cause a multitude of problems including symptoms of depression and sleep-related disorders such as insomnia or restlessness. Sleep affects a large chunk of our lives; we spend about one third of our lives sleeping, so if you’re not getting the best quality sleep, you should have a working air conditioning system at home.
